小米 – 智能驾驶-仿真测试工程师 职位分析和面试指导

职位描述:

1. 基于产品功能开发需求,设计、建设和维护智能驾驶HIL测试系统或数据回灌测试系统,开发各类智驾传感器仿真模块,满足智驾功能安全、预期功能安全、法规准入等测试需求。
2. 依据产品与系统需求文档,编写并评审智驾仿真测试用例,搭建与管理测试场景集,满足功能、性能、故障注入和可靠性测试等多种测试需求,确保测试对功能需求的全面覆盖。
3. 推进台架测试能力提升,包括编写与优化自动化工具框架,提升团队自动化测试效率与质量,持续提升组织技术能力。
4. 与研发、质量、整车等部门密切合作,推进测试计划和测试执行进度,及时发布测试报告并推进测试问题解决。
5. 关注自动驾驶领域的前沿发展动态,引入新的自动化测试方法、先进的测试工具和创新技术,改进现有测试工具和方法,满足多种测试场景需求。

职位要求:

1. 本科及以上学历,计算机、电子、自动化、车辆等相关专业,本科5年或硕士3年以上工作经验,有车载软件测试管理或测试开发相关经验者优先。
2. 熟练掌握至少一种HIL仿真测试工具,如dSPACE、NI等,熟练使用VTD、Prescan等仿真软件。
3. 熟悉C/C++或Python编程语言,具备良好的编程能力,能够设计和开发数据回灌工具链、自动化脚本和测试框架,熟练进行Ros Bag解析、数据格式转换、场景重构等操作,具备快速排查算法与数据一致性问题的能力。
4. 具备较强的学习能力、自驱力和团队合作精神,能快速适应新技术,推动自动驾驶测试技术的不断创新,与各团队紧密配合,高效推进项目落地。

招聘部门:

小米

工作地点:

上海市 ID:A71067

面试建议:

小米智能驾驶仿真测试工程师这个岗位非常注重工程实践能力与技术深度的结合。从职位描述可以看出,这不仅仅是一个普通的测试岗位,而是要求候选人能够搭建完整的测试系统架构,并具备从底层工具链开发到高层测试场景设计的全栈能力。特别是对HIL系统、数据回灌测试这些专业领域的深度要求,以及需要同时掌握仿真软件和编程开发的双重技能,这些都使得这个岗位在自动驾驶测试领域具有相当的挑战性。 建议应聘者重点准备三个方面的内容:首先是对HIL测试系统的实战经验,要能详细说明你使用dSPACE或NI工具解决过的具体问题;其次是编程能力的展示,特别是用Python/C++开发测试工具链的案例;最后要准备自动驾驶测试方法论的理解,包括如何设计测试用例来覆盖功能安全需求。面试时可能会遇到现场分析测试数据的环节,所以要对Ros Bag解析和场景重构保持熟练度。记住这个岗位特别看重将测试需求转化为工程解决方案的能力,所以回答问题时要突出你的系统思维和工程化能力。

在线咨询


请输入您的问题:

提示:由 AI 生成回答,可能存在错误,请注意甄别。